Vaijnath Shinde is an Indian politician from the Indian National Congress and currently[when?] a Member of Legislative Assembly (MLA) in the Maharashtra. In 2009, he contested election from the Latur Rural and defeated Ramesh Karad of Bharatiya Janata Party & Independent Dilip Nade by over 23583 votes.
